深度学习在NLP中的应用与优势:一次技术范式的变革
谈到人工智能最贴近日常的领域,自然语言处理(NLP)绝对榜上有名。近年来,一股由深度学习驱动的浪潮彻底重塑了这片疆域,不仅带来了前所未有的应用能力,也悄然完成了一次与传统方法的技术范式交接。下面,我们就来细数这些关键应用,并看看深度学习究竟带来了哪些不同。
一、深度学习在NLP中的几个重要应用
深度学习绝非纸上谈兵,它已经在NLP的多个核心场景中大放异彩,实实在在地解决着具体问题——
机器翻译:过去跨语言沟通总隔着一层生硬的“翻译腔”,而今,基于神经网络的翻译模型已经能相当流畅地实现源语言到目标语言的转换。准确性与效率的双重提升,让全球信息流动的门槛显著降低。
情感分析:判断一段文字是褒是贬,对人类来说可能轻而易举,但对机器则不然。深度学习模型通过训练,已经能自动化、精准地识别文本中的情感倾向(积极、消极或中性)。这个能力在分析海量产品评论、监测社交媒体舆情时,堪称利器。
自然语言生成与理解:这是实现自然、智能人机交互的核心。深度学习不仅能让计算机根据结构化数据写出通顺的报道或摘要(生成),更能让它真正“读懂”用户指令或文档的深层含义(理解)。你会发现,如今的智能助手,确实比以前更“明白事儿”了。
文本分类:面对汹涌而来的信息流,如何自动归档?深度学习为此提供了高效方案。无论是新闻按主题自动归类,还是从海量邮件中精准识别垃圾信息,模型都能快速、可靠地完成文本类别的划分。
命名实体识别:在一段普通文本中,快速定位出关键的人名、机构名、地名等特定实体,是构建知识图谱、进行信息抽取的第一步。深度学习模型在这项任务上展现出了极高的准确率,为上层知识服务打下了坚实基础。
二、一场静悄悄的革命:与传统方法的深度比较
深度学习并非凭空出现,它是在与传统方法的比较和超越中确立自身地位的。二者的差异,主要体现在以下几个维度:
特征提取方式:传统方法像一位严谨的手工艺人,高度依赖专家设计规则和定义特征(即“特征工程”),这个过程费时费力且需要深厚的领域知识。深度学习则更像一位拥有强大自学能力的学生,它能够直接从原始文本数据中,自动抽丝剥茧,学习到那些最能代表语义的高层次特征,极大减少了对人工干预的依赖。
语义理解能力:传统方法在捕捉语言的微妙语义和复杂上下文时,往往力不从心。而深度学习通过构建多层的神经网络,形成了深度的抽象与理解能力,能够更好地把握“言外之意”和上下文关联。因此,在面对语义消歧、指袋里解等复杂任务时,其表现更为出色。
数据需求与性能天花板:这里有一个有趣的“ trade-off ”(权衡)。传统方法在特定、垂直、数据量有限的领域,凭借精心设计的规则,往往能“小快灵”地解决问题。然而,到了大数据时代,深度学习的优势就凸显出来了:它能够通过海量数据进行端到端的训练,数据越多,其模型性能的天花板就越高,最终在多数任务上实现反超。
可解释性与可控性:传统方法因为规则和特征都是人工明确定义的,所以其决策过程如同白盒,清晰可见,易于调整和控制。而深度学习模型,尤其是大型神经网络,其内部数以亿计的参数如何协同工作,最终给出某个判断,这个过程更像一个“黑盒”,解释起来颇具挑战。但话说回来,这种复杂性换来的,往往是性能上更优的结果。
综上所述,深度学习的引入,无疑为NLP领域打开了更广阔的应用前景。它在核心任务上的卓越表现,以及从特征学习到语义理解的全方位优势,清晰地标示了技术发展的主流方向。当然,这并不意味着传统方法完全退出舞台,在某些特定、可解释性要求极高的场景,它们依然不可替代。未来的发展,或许更倾向于两者的融合与互补。
